Output 46e05a76643c5c1112062f5091843ad2289881f28979a2eb0d239a7a298a4196:1

value
66407
script pubkey
OP_0 OP_PUSHBYTES_20 baf6bbde312b9a7ad58e2e999017914219627d6d
address
bc1qhtmthh339wd844vw96veq9u3ggvkyltdr9h4uh
transaction
46e05a76643c5c1112062f5091843ad2289881f28979a2eb0d239a7a298a4196
spent
true